Programs Offered
Bachelor of Science in Aircraft Maintenance and Technology (BSAMT)
Guided by the University Mission, the Perpetualite Aviators must be able to:
Utilize their technical knowledge and skills to thrive in Aviation practice
Apply professional ethics with a deep sense of Christian Values in fulfilling the needs of the society
Student Outcomes:
Demonstrate comprehensive knowledge of aircraft systems
Apply maintenance and troubleshooting skills
Interpret technical manuals and documentation
Utilize industry-standard tools and equipment
Adhere to safety protocols and regulations
Collaborate effectively in a team environment
Demonstrate professionalism and ethics
Stay updated with industry advancements
Exhibit critical thinking and problem-solving abilities
Communicate effectively
Perform comprehensive inspections of aircraft systems and components
Conduct preventative maintenance and scheduled servicing of aircraft
Troubleshoot and diagnose avionics and electrical system issues
Apply knowledge of aviation regulations and compliance standards
Demonstrate proficiency in aviation industry software and diagnostic tools
Effectively document maintenance activities and generate accurate reports
Apply problem-solving skills to resolve complex technical issues
Demonstrate understanding of aircraft performance and flight characteristics
Implement effective time management and prioritization skills
Develop a strong foundation in mathematics, physics, and engineering principles relevant to aviation technology
